The procedure begins using an HPHT seed crystal that is definitely inserted into a CVD reactor chamber. A concoction of gases, primarily hydrogen (ninety five%-99%) and methane gasoline (one%-five%), is injected into your chamber and heated by a microwave beam. The gas molecules break up and are interested in the cooler Component of the chamber wherever the seed is very carefully temperature managed. The molecules practically rain down on to the seed, increasing diamond in layers. When the final products arrives out, it won't appear very similar to normal diamond rough - It is really inside of a dice condition and has black carbon encompassing it. Using a laser, the growers will Slash off this excessive carbon and usually handle the tough utilizing the HPHT course of action to get rid of the brownish tint (this can be a steady system referred to as post-progress cure and may be detailed around the grading report).
